Comments  
Room were spacious.  Room No. 7 is by the chain locker, but the Captain
timed the arrivals for 0630h, so guests were not awakened in the middle of
the night.  Health corals.  Some huge wrasse, sweetlips, grouper; but, most
of the critters were small:  nudi's, shrimps, blue ribbon eels, flatworms,
macro stuff.  All diving done from skiffs; hard-bottom inflatables with
boarding ladder only on request.  Most diving done in open water, with
occasionally unpredictable currents.  Divemasters were personable, eager to
point out unusual finds.  We combined the Fiji destination with the Solomon
Islands, with 4 days between the trips for R and R.
